Inspect Sprinkler Heads for Damages and Obstructions
Prior to you turn on your lawn sprinkler system for the season, it's essential to check the lawn sprinkler heads for any type of damage or blockages. You'll desire to assure that water can flow freely when the system activates.
If you see any kind of clogged heads, eliminate them and saturate them in a service of vinegar and water to dissolve mineral down payments. Taking these actions will certainly assist guarantee your lawn sprinkler system runs effectively throughout the period.

Evaluate the Controller and Timers
Examining the controller and timers of your sprinkler system is crucial for keeping an effective sprinkling schedule. Beginning by examining the setups on your controller. Make certain the date and time are correct; this assurances your system runs as intended. Next, evaluate the sprinkling timetable to confirm it aligns with your landscaping needs and regional climate condition.
Run a manual examination cycle for each zone to confirm it triggers appropriately. Look for any kind of delays or breakdowns, as these can suggest issues needing attention. Readjust the run times and regularity if you observe any type of areas more than- or under-watered.
Also, acquaint on your own with the rain hold-up attribute if your controller has one; it assists check here conserve water during wet durations. On a regular basis testing your controller and timers not only conserves water but also promotes much healthier plants and a vivid landscape.
Tidy Filters and Displays
On a regular basis cleaning up screens and filters is important for keeping your lawn sprinkler working effectively. Gradually, debris, mineral, and dust accumulation can obstruct these parts, bring about irregular water circulation and lowered performance. Beginning by situating the filters and displays in your system, which are typically discovered at the major line and private sprinkler heads.
Once you've identified them, turn off the water and meticulously remove each filter or display. Rinse them under running water to displace any kind of accumulation. For persistent down payments, use a soft brush and light detergent, however prevent harsh chemicals that could harm the parts.
After cleansing, reassemble every little thing and double-check for any noticeable wear or damage. If you see anything unusual, think about changing the filters or screens to assure peak performance - Sprinkler tune-up. By keeping tidy filters and displays, you'll help your lawn sprinkler run efficiently and efficiently

Check Lawn Sprinkler Heads
Examining your lawn sprinkler check here heads is crucial for assessing water pressure and ensuring also distribution throughout your yard. Start by inspecting each head for obstructions or damages. Clear any kind of particles or dirt that may be obstructing the flow. Next, observe the spray pattern; it should be constant and get to the desired locations without merging. Change the heads accordingly or change any type of that are broken if you observe unequal insurance coverage. In addition, assess the water pressure at each head; expensive can create misting, while too reduced might result in insufficient watering. You may need to adjust your stress regulatory authority or consult an expert if you discover discrepancies. Routine evaluation helps preserve a healthy, lively landscape and prevents drainage.

Exactly how Usually Should I Carry Out a Tune-Up on My Lawn Sprinkler?
You need to execute a tune-up on your lawn sprinkler system at least annually, ideally before the expanding period. Routine upkeep assists ensure performance, stops leakages, and maintains your grass healthy and hydrated throughout the year.
Can I Do a Tune-Up Myself or Work With an Expert?
If you're convenient and have the right tools,You can most definitely do a tune-up yourself. However, working with an expert guarantees everything's done appropriately, which could conserve you time and prospective frustrations down the line.
What Devices Do I Need for a Lawn Sprinkler System Tune-Up?
You'll need a couple of essential tools for your lawn sprinkler system tune-up: a screwdriver, pliers, a wrench, a yard pipe, and a timer. Having these useful will certainly make your tune-up procedure smoother and more reliable.
Are There Seasonal Considerations for Automatic Sprinkler Maintenance?
Yes, there are seasonal factors to consider for maintaining your lawn sprinkler. You'll intend to readjust sprinkling schedules based on temperature level modifications, prepare for winter by draining pipes, and assurance proper protection during spring growth.
Just How Can I Boost Water Effectiveness in My Automatic Sprinkler?
To enhance water efficiency in your lawn sprinkler, adjust the sprinkling timetable based upon climate conditions, install drip irrigation, make use of rain sensing units, and regularly examine for leaks or blockages to ensure peak efficiency.
